Specific embodiment
To further illustrate the technical scheme of the present invention below with reference to the accompanying drawings and specific embodiments.
As shown in Figs. 1-2, a kind of outer wall glazing device, including gantry frame 100, blank grabbing device 200 and leaching glaze dress
Set 300;The blank grabbing device 200 is slidably mounted on the gantry frame 100, the leaching glaze device by driving device
300 are located at the lower section of the gantry frame 100;
The leaching glaze device 300 carries Dropbox 320 including horizontal be equipped in glaze hopper 310, the glaze hopper 310, described
It carries Dropbox 320 and the gantry frame 100 is installed on by telescopic rod.
This programme carries out glazing processing by setting blank grabbing device 200 and leaching glaze device 300, to the external of product,
Soaking glaze itself is to impregnate just to take out green body in glaze hopper, in the case where guaranteeing working efficiency, also ensures matter
Amount, and the setting of Dropbox 320 is carried, making cup body, green body is in immersion process and lifts by the restraining force of inside and outside both direction
Cheng Zhong will not fall off from grabbing device 200 easily, avoid the problem that cup body falls off the shut-down of generation.
Wherein, it is equipped with bracket below the glaze hopper 310, lifting device is equipped between the glaze hopper 310 and bracket.
For adjusting the height of glaze hopper 310, the height of glaze hopper can also determine the depth that blank immerses.
It wherein, further include raffinate wiping arrangement 400, the raffinate wiping arrangement 400 is located under the glaze spraying device 300
Swim position;
The raffinate wiping arrangement 400 includes rack, roller component 410 and pressing roller 420, and the roller component 410 is pacified
Top loaded on the rack, the roller component 410 are driven by driving device, the pressing roller 420 and the roller component
Outermost roller is close in 410;
410 outer cover of roller component is equipped with water sucting belt 430, and the roller component 410 drives 430 turns of the water sucting belt
Dynamic, the water sucting belt 430 is pulled into plane by the roller component 410.
Raffinate wiping arrangement 400 in this programme is the device of second of wiping raffinate, at work, is grabbed and is filled by blank
200 are set from the clamping of glaze spraying device 300, the raffinate of blank rim of a cup is wiped again by the water sucting belt 430 of rotation, is inhaled
Water band 430 is after absorbing glaze, when turning to 420 position of pressing roller, the liquid that water sucting belt 430 absorbs is squeezed out to come,
Water sucting belt is set to be in the state that can be absorbed water always.
In addition, further include raffinate recycling bins, the raffinate recycling bins are located at the roller component 410 and pressing roller 420
Lower section.
Raffinate recycling bins are used to recycle water sucting belt 430 and squeeze out the glaze come, the glaze of recycling can be carried out secondary benefit
With.
In addition, the blank grabbing device 200 includes translation mechanism 210, elevating mechanism 220 and grasping mechanism 230;
The elevating mechanism 220 is installed on the translation mechanism 210, and the grasping mechanism 230 is installed on the elevator
The lower end of structure 220;
The translation mechanism 210 is moved along the upstream and downstream of the gantry frame 100.
Wherein, the crawl position positioned at front is preceding crawl position 231, and the upper end that position 231 is grabbed before described is rotatablely installed in institute
The lower part of elevating mechanism is stated, the elevating mechanism 220 is equipped with cylinder, and the cylinder both ends are hingedly connected to the preceding crawl position
Middle part and the elevating mechanism lower end, the cylinder push it is described before crawl position swing.
Blank is immersed glaze hopper 310 after grabbing workpiece, with inclined posture by preceding crawl, to make green body bottom
Concave inward structure can be contacted adequately with glaze, avoid the occurrence of bubble, influence glazing effect.
In addition, middle part crawl position and tail portion crawl position are additionally provided with before described at the downstream of crawl position, three different locations
Crawl position all use sucker structure, the crawl position of different location is respectively equipped with independent gas source.
Multiple crawl positions cover the position that most of technique is put, independent gas source are respectively set, and make each crawl position
Work it is respectively independent.
